Doctorate in Child Psychology Curriculum & Courses. Curriculum and courses in a child psychology doctoral program generally center around classroom lecture, research, and field experience or practicums. Child psychologists work with children to diagnose and treat various developmental, behavioral, and mental disorders. To become a child psychologist, candidates need a Ph.D. or Psy.D. in psychology or a related field. The Clinical Psychology Program offers separate but highly overlapping General Clinical and Child Clinical tracks. The Child Clinical track offers specialized coursework in the assessment, etiology, and treatment of psychological disorders of childhood, adolescence, and young adulthood, whereas the General track covers the assessment, etiology ... A child psychologist has professional training and clinical skills to evaluate and treat the mental, emotional, social and behavioral health of infants, toddlers, children and adolescents. Child psychologists have a thorough understanding of the basic psychological needs of children and adolescents and how their family and other social contexts ...
